Is Traditional Nutella Vegan? Understanding the Dairy Difference

Many fans of the beloved chocolate hazelnut spread often wonder if it fits into a vegan diet. Unfortunately, the answer is no, traditional Nutella is not vegan. Its recipe includes milk and other dairy products, making it unsuitable for those following a plant-based lifestyle or with dairy allergies. While some store-bought alternatives, like Nocciolata’s dairy-free spread, are available for convenience, nothing quite compares to the fresh, vibrant taste and customizable nature of homemade vegan Nutella. Creating it yourself ensures you know exactly what goes into your spread, free from unwanted additives and preservatives, and bursting with pure, wholesome flavor.

The Magic of Minimal Ingredients: What You’ll Need

One of the most appealing aspects of this vegan Nutella recipe is its incredible simplicity. On a scale of 1 to easy, it’s practically effortless, requiring minimal ingredients that pack maximum flavor. You only need these core components to craft your own batch of irresistible dairy-free chocolate hazelnut spread:

  • Hazelnuts: The star of the show! Raw hazelnuts are preferred as we’ll roast them ourselves to unlock their full flavor potential.
  • Vegan Chocolate: Choose your favorite high-quality dairy-free chocolate. Brands like Pascha Chocolate or Enjoy Life are excellent choices for their rich flavor and reliable melting properties. For a Paleo-friendly option, Hu Kitchen is fantastic.
  • Coconut Cream, Vegan Butter, or Cashew Cream: This ingredient adds essential creaminess and helps achieve that characteristic smooth, luxurious texture. Coconut cream (from a can of full-fat coconut milk) is a popular choice, but melted vegan butter or homemade cashew cream work beautifully too.
  • Cocoa Powder (or Cacao Powder): This enhances the chocolate flavor and contributes to the deep, rich color of the spread. Use unsweetened cocoa powder for best results.
  • A Pinch of Sea Salt (Optional): A tiny pinch can really elevate the flavors, balancing the sweetness and deepening the chocolate notes.

That’s truly all it takes! If you’re using a very dark or unsweetened chocolate (like 100% cacao), you might want to add a tablespoon or two of maple syrup, agave, or your preferred sugar-free sweetener to adjust the bitterness to your liking. However, if your vegan chocolate is already sweetened and balanced, such as many Paleo-friendly options like Hu Kitchen, additional sugar might not be necessary, allowing you to enjoy a naturally sweet treat.

Crafting Perfection: A Step-by-Step Guide to Homemade Vegan Nutella

Achieving the creamiest, silkiest vegan chocolate hazelnut spread that rivals store-bought versions (without requiring any fancy high-tech equipment!) is simpler than you might think. There are a few key tricks to master, but rest assured, they are far from complicated and will ensure your homemade Nutella has an incredibly smooth consistency.

To embark on your journey to easy vegan Nutella bliss, simply follow these steps:

  1. Preheat and Prepare Hazelnuts: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or tin foil and spread your raw hazelnuts in a single layer.
  2. Roast for Flavor and Texture: Toast the hazelnuts in the preheated oven for approximately 10 minutes. This crucial step is not just about cooking them; it significantly enhances their natural aroma and releases their oils, which are vital for achieving a super smooth butter later on. Roasting also makes the hazelnut skins much easier to remove.
  3. Remove Hazelnut Skins: Once toasted, immediately transfer the warm hazelnuts into a clean kitchen towel. Gather the corners of the towel to create a pouch and begin rubbing the towel vigorously over the hazelnuts. This friction helps to loosen and remove most of the papery skins. While aiming for as much skin removal as possible will result in a smoother butter, don’t fret if a few stubborn bits remain.
  4. Process Hazelnuts into Butter: Place the skinned hazelnuts into a high-powered food processor. Begin blending, scraping down the sides as needed. Initially, the hazelnuts will chop into coarse crumbs, then form a clumpy meal, and eventually release their oils, transforming into a thick, semi-smooth butter. Continue blending until they reach a relatively smooth consistency, though it may still be somewhat clumpy.
  5. Melt the Vegan Chocolate: While the hazelnuts are processing, gently melt your chosen vegan chocolate. Break the chocolate bar into small pieces and place them in a small microwave-safe bowl. Microwave in 30-second increments, stirring well after each interval, until the chocolate is completely smooth and glossy. Alternatively, you can use a double boiler on the stovetop for a more controlled melting process.
  6. Combine and Blend: Pour the melted vegan chocolate directly into the food processor with the hazelnut butter. Add the coconut cream (or vegan butter/cashew cream) and cocoa powder (or cacao powder).
  7. Achieve Ultimate Smoothness: Secure the lid of the food processor and blend the mixture continuously. This final blending stage is key to achieving that perfectly smooth and creamy Nutella texture. It will take approximately 5 minutes, depending on the power of your food processor, for all the ingredients to fully emulsify into a luxurious spread. Be patient; the mixture will transform into a truly decadent consistency.
  8. Store Your Creation: Once perfectly smooth, transfer your homemade vegan Nutella into an airtight jar. You can store it on your countertop for up to 5 days, or extend its freshness by refrigerating it for up to a month. Customizing Your Spread: Nut Substitutions and Allergen-Friendly Options

Can I Swap in Other Nuts?

Absolutely! While this recipe celebrates the classic chocolate hazelnut flavor, feel free to experiment with other nuts. You can easily substitute hazelnuts with an equal amount of peanuts, cashews, walnuts, or even macadamia nuts for a different, yet equally delicious, chocolate nut butter. Just remember, while these variations will be fantastic, they won’t technically be a “chocolate hazelnut” spread anymore, but rather a unique chocolate peanut, cashew, or walnut butter.

Is There a Way to Make This Vegan Nutella Nut-Free?

For those with nut allergies or preferences, this recipe can indeed be adapted to be completely nut-free. Simply swap the hazelnuts for sunflower seeds or pumpkin seeds. The process remains the same: roast the seeds, then blend them with the vegan chocolate, coconut cream, and cocoa powder. The result will be a delightful chocolate seed spread, offering a similar creamy texture and rich flavor without any nuts.

Endless Delights: Creative Ways to Savor Your Homemade Vegan Nutella

Beyond the obvious spoonful straight from the jar (we all do it!), this homemade vegan Nutella unlocks a world of culinary possibilities. Its rich, creamy texture and deep chocolate-hazelnut flavor make it a versatile addition to countless dishes. Here are just a few of my personal favorite ways to enjoy this delectable spread:

  • Classic Toast Topping: Spread generously on sprouted toast and top with sliced bananas and a sprinkle of cacao nibs for an elevated breakfast.
  • Ice Cream Swirl: Swirl a dollop into your favorite vegan ice cream for an instant upgrade, or simply drizzle it on top.
  • Baking Masterpiece: Use it as a decadent filling to replace jam in delightful vegan Linzer cookies, or as a base for frosting.
  • Pancake & Waffle Perfection: Drizzle liberally over fluffy gluten-free vegan “buttermilk” pancakes or crispy gluten-free vegan waffles for a truly indulgent brunch.
  • Overnight Oats Boost: Stir a spoonful into your chocolatey protein vegan overnight oats for an extra layer of flavor and richness, turning a simple breakfast into a treat.
  • Cake Filling or Frosting: Integrate it into our vegan chocolate hazelnut cake for an explosion of flavor, or thin it slightly to create a glossy glaze.
  • Banana Bread Swirl: Swirl it through our classic vegan banana bread batter before baking for a marbled, nutty chocolate surprise.
  • Fruit Dip: Serve alongside fresh fruit like strawberries, apple slices, or pear wedges for a healthy yet indulgent snack.
  • Smoothie Enhancer: Add a tablespoon to your morning smoothie for a boost of healthy fats, protein, and incredible chocolate flavor.

Easy Vegan Nutella {Whole30, Paleo} Recipe

Average Rating: 4.8 from 4 reviews

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 5 minutes
  • Total Time: 15 minutes
  • Yield: Approximately 16 oz

Description

You won’t believe how easy this 4-ingredient vegan Nutella is to make! Silky smooth, decadently rich, and nutty chocolate hazelnut spread that’s made with simple dairy-free ingredients and tastes identical to the classic spread!

Ingredients

  • 16 oz raw hazelnuts
  • 1 (5-ounce) bar vegan chocolate (see note for Paleo-friendly options)
  • 1/4 cup (60 mL) coconut cream or cashew cream
  • 1 tbsp cocoa powder or cacao powder
  • 1 pinch sea salt (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a baking sheet with tin foil.
  2. Toast the hazelnuts in the oven for 10 minutes. This brings out their aroma and oils, making them easier to blend and helping to remove their skin.
  3. Once the hazelnuts are toasted, immediately place them (while still warm) into a clean kitchen towel. Wrap them up and begin rubbing the towel over the hazelnuts to remove their skins. This step contributes to a really smooth hazelnut butter. Don’t worry if not all of the skin comes off!
  4. Place the skinned hazelnuts into a high-powered food processor. Blend until the hazelnuts are semi-smooth but still a bit clumpy, gradually forming a butter.
  5. In a small bowl, melt the vegan chocolate. Microwave in 30-second increments, stirring after each, until the chocolate is completely smooth.
  6. Pour the melted chocolate into the food processor with the hazelnut butter. Add the coconut cream and cacao powder.
  7. Puree the Nutella until it’s completely smooth and creamy. This step may take about 5 minutes, depending on your food processor’s power, so be patient for the best texture.
  8. Pour the vegan Nutella into an airtight jar and store on the countertop for up to 5 days, or in the fridge for up to a month. It’s so delicious, it likely won’t last that long!

Notes

Paleo Option: For a Paleo-friendly vegan Nutella, I highly recommend using either Hu Kitchen chocolate or Pascha Organics 100% dark chocolate chips. If you’re using Pascha and prefer a less bitter taste, you might want to add a tablespoon of maple syrup or another natural sweetener to balance the flavor.
